Nestlé to represent SL at ‘Cannes Internatio­nal Festival of Creativity’

-

Nestlé’s Umeshinie Kurukulasu­riya and Ashani Ratnayake have won the prestigiou­s Cannes Lions Young Marketer Sri Lanka 2017. The duo competed against teams from leading companies to win the local title, and will represent Sri Lanka in the Young Lions Competitio­n at the 64th Cannes Lions Internatio­nal Festival of Creativity in France, going head-to-head with teams from across the globe.

“Our experience at Nestlé, not just in marketing but also in innovating and renovating products and catering to evolving consumer needs, is what gave us the edge to win this competitio­n. We are honoured and delighted to represent Sri Lanka in the upcoming Young Lions Competitio­n,” said Umeshinie Kurukulasu­riya, Brand Manager – Nescafé and Ashani Ratnayake, Assistant Brand Manager – Nestomalt in a joint media release issued by Nestle.

This is the second time Nestlé has won Cannes Lions Young Marketer Sri Lanka. The Lion awards are the most coveted and well respected in the entire advertisin­g and creative communicat­ions industry. It is part of the Cannes Lions Internatio­nal Festival of Creativity, an eight day festival that is considered the largest global gathering of advertisin­g profession­als, designers, digital innovators and marketers.
